Electrophilic difluoro(phenylthio)methylation: generation, stability, and reactivity of α-fluorocarbocations
Nolan M Betterley1, Panida Surawatanawong, Samran Prabpai
1Department of Chemistry and Center of Excellence for Innovation in Chemistry (PERCH-CIC), Faculty of Science, Mahidol University , Rama VI Road, Bangkok 10400, Thailand.
Abstract:
Electrophilic difluoro(phenylthio)methylation of allylsilanes has been achieved using bromodifluoro(phenylthio)methane (PhSCF2Br) and silver hexafluoroantimonate (AgSbF6). The structural assignment and observation of α-fluorocarbocation were substantiated by NMR and theoretical calculations. Detailed mechanistic and electronic studies have provided a fundamental understanding of the reactivity and stability of the difluoro(phenylthio)methylium cation (PhSCF2(+)).
